How can employers effectively incorporate empathy into their company culture to improve overall job satisfaction and employee retention rates?
Employers can effectively incorporate empathy into their company culture by fostering open communication and actively listening to employees' concerns and feedback. They can also provide opportunities for professional development and support work-life balance to show they care about their employees' well-being. Additionally, implementing policies that prioritize mental health and wellness, as well as recognizing and rewarding employees for their hard work, can help improve job satisfaction and retention rates. Overall, creating a supportive and understanding work environment where employees feel valued and respected can significantly enhance their overall experience and loyalty to the company.
